Characterization Of The Mechanical Proper Ties Of Unsaturated Polyester Reinforced With Varying Fraction Of Particulate Groundnut Shell

ABSTRACT

The objective of this study is to produce and determine the mechanical properties as well as water absorption characteristics of unsaturated polyester-groundnut shell particle composite. The aim of the study with varying weight of groundnut shell particle is to find the composite with optimum mechanical properties. Groundnut shell of undersize particle of 300 microns was introduced at different percentages into the unsaturated polyester resin. Composites were produced at 2%, 4%, 6%. 8% and I 0% volume fraction of groundnut shell particle tillers and the polyester was cast neat at 0% groundnut shell particle filler which served as the control. Mechanical properties of the composites such as tensile properties (tensile stress, tensile strain, Young's modulus, tensile strength and percentage elongation at fracture), flexural strength and hardness were experimentally determined in the engineering laboratories using Double cell Universal Instron machine (Instron 3369) at a cross head speed of 5mm/min and a load cell capacity of 50KN, Rockwell hardness testing machine (HRA 60) and Taber abrasive machine at 150 RPM. Water absorption test was also carried out on the samples. The tensile test specimen preparation and testing procedures were conducted in accordance with the ASTM. Results of the mechanical property tests showed increase in hardness, flexural strength and Young's modulus. The tensile prope1ties showed: that at I 0¾GSF the highest tensile strength of 783MPa compared to the control of I 0.84155 MPa, the cast composite with I 0wt¾ GSF had the best tensile modulus of 783MPa. Increasing the volume fraction of groundnut shell particle filler from 0% to 2%, 4%, 6% and 8% led to decrease in tensile strength from I 0.84 I 55MPa to I 0.29971 MPa of the reinforced composites. The wear property of the composite was enhanced at 4wt% and had the best wear index of 1.04 compared to the control of 0.251.The polymer composites showed irregular pattern in their water absorption prope11y with 2wt¾GSF having the highest water absorption prope11y and 4wt% having the poorest water absorption property. It was deduced from the study that, the groundnut shell reinforced polyester composite will perform in engineering areas of application that require mild strength such as in window frames of automobiles, casing of electrical appliances, and floors of airplanes. Also, Surface coating of groundnut shell particle filler could be used to improve its adhesion to the polyester matrix in order to enhance the mechanical properties of the composites for other engineering applications.
